Heat Treatment Part 9: Aging Treatment

Aging Treatment of Alloys

Aging treatment, also known as precipitation hardening, is a key step in modern heat treatment technology. This process follows solution treatment and involves heating alloys at a controlled temperature to allow the formation of fine precipitates, which strengthen the metal.

Heat Treatment Part 8: Solution Treatment

Solution Treatment

In the field of heat treatment, solution treatment (also known as solid solution treatment) is a critical process for improving the mechanical and corrosion-resistant properties of metals, especially stainless steels, nickel-based alloys, and aluminum alloys. The process involves heating the alloy to a high temperature to dissolve alloying elements into a solid solution, followed by rapid cooling to retain this uniform structure.

Top 5 Applications of Tube Furnaces in Materials Science

1500°C High Temperature Tube Furnaces

Tube furnaces are widely used in materials science due to their ability to deliver precise, high-temperature environments under controlled atmospheres. They play a critical role in research and development across various fields such as metallurgy, ceramics, crystal growth, and nanomaterials.

The Role of 1200°C Muffle Furnace in New Material Research

1200°C Muffle Furnace in New Material Research

The 1200°C programmable muffle furnace is a fundamental tool in new material research, enabling precise heat treatments for ceramics, MMCs, and other advanced materials. Its applications in sintering, annealing, and decomposition studies support the development of high-performance materials for industries such as aerospace, electronics, and energy storage.
